The dishwasher hums, the sink fills up, and the rhythm of everyday housework quietly shapes family life. In this episode of Notes, I reflect on the emotional texture of daily chores and the invisible labor that often defines motherhood.What seems like mundane housework - loading the dishwasher, cleaning up after dinner, wiping down counters - becomes part of the steady rhythm of raising a child.
